Harley Davidson introduces its most affordable motorcycle, the Street 500, in the US market
Harley Davidson Street 500

After launching the Street 750 in the Indian market at the 2014 Auto Expo in February, Harley Davidson has now brought in its most affordable motorcycle in the US market. The Harley Davidson Street 500 was launched at $6,799 (Rs 4.10 lakh) in the United States. 

The smallest displacement motorcycle to come off the HD production lines, the Street 500 is powered by the new Revolution X 494cc liquid cooled V-twin engine. This is the same engine that works on its elder sibling, but has been detuned to produce 40Nm of torque instead of 60Nm. The Street 500 too is mated to a 6-speed gearbox. The American motorcycle manufacturer claims that the Street 500 will return an efficiency of 17.4kmpl under mixed conditions in the US. 

In the looks department the 2015 Street 500 is identical to the Street 750 and follows the Dark Custom styling. The Street 500 too sports the Night Rod inspired headlights with a cafe style speed screen, a short mud guard, teardrop shaped tank and LED tail light at the back. The Street 500 also has the two-in-one exhausts and pull-back handle bars.

With the Street 750, Harley Davidson has already made its entry into the affordable performance bike segment and with the launch of the smaller Street 500 it only wants to further the cause. In fact both these bikes cater to a whole new audience as opposed to the other models in the Harley Davidson stable. The Harley Davidson Street 500 is likely to go on sale in India early next year. While it will surely be priced lower than the 750, we expect it to be around Rs 3.6 lakh.
